Why Kansas City Foundations Frequently Required Attention
Large soils and wetness swings
Many structure issues are connected to dirt motion. "Large" clay soils swell when they take in water and shrink as they dry out-- developing cycles of heave, settlement, and side pressure that can split or change foundations.
Freeze-- thaw stress and anxiety on concrete
Kansas City winters include another element: water that gets in tiny pores and fractures can ice up and expand, producing stress that contributes to splitting and deterioration. Water broadens by concerning 9% when it freezes, which is why repeated freeze-- thaw cycles can be so harmful to concrete with time.
The takeaway: when moisture administration is poor (seamless gutters, grading, drainage), the soil and concrete around your home can relocate greater than they should-- resulting in architectural and water-intrusion troubles.
Foundation Repair Kansas City: What It Covers and When It's Needed
Foundation Repair Kansas City is an umbrella term for structural stablizing and improvement. The right repair depends upon what's taking place (settlement, wall motion, bad water drainage, or a mix).
Common warning signs
Stair-step fractures in brick or block
Angled drywall splits near doors/windows
Doors that stick or will not lock
Uneven, sloping, or "bouncy" floors
Bowing basement walls
Normal fixing approaches (picked after inspection).
Piers (push piers/helical piers): Used to support and often raise clearing up structures by moving lots to much deeper, extra secure dirts.
Wall surface supports or supporting systems: Designed to stabilize bowing walls and reduce inward movement over time.
Carbon fiber reinforcement: Frequently used for wall stabilization when movement is moderate and access is good.
A reliable professional should explain why the movement is happening (often moisture + dirt) and just how the repair service stops additional displacement-- not just how it "spots" the signs and symptom.
Foundation Crack Repair Kansas City: Securing vs. Structural Fixes.
Not every crack coincides, and Foundation Crack Repair Kansas City can suggest extremely different things depending on the reason.
Non-structural (leak-focused) split repair services.
If a fracture is allowing water infiltration yet the wall surface is otherwise stable, pros generally make use of:.
Urethane injection (flexible; helpful for water securing).
Epoxy injection (more inflexible; can bring back some structural continuity in particular fracture types).
Architectural fracture repair work.
If a crack is related to continuous movement-- like bowing wall surfaces, active settlement, or widening/offset splits-- sealing alone is usually not nearly enough. That's where reinforcement (carbon fiber, bracing, supports) or underpinning piers may be advised.
A great inspection consists of determining crack size, checking for variation, and searching for related concerns such as wall turning or floor splitting up.
Basement Waterproofing Kansas City: A System, Not a Single Item.
Basement Waterproofing Kansas City is most efficient Sump Pump Replacement Kansas City when it's treated as a total water-management system. In practice, that usually suggests managing:.
Surface area water (roofing system drainage + grading).
Subsurface water (hydrostatic pressure around the structure).
Interior moisture (air quality and mold and mildew risk).
Usual waterproofing components.
Outside improvements: expanded downspouts, proper grading, water drainage adjustments.
Inside perimeter drains pipes: accumulate water that goes into at the cove joint (wall/floor joint) and route it to a sump container.
Sump pump system: pumps collected water away from the structure.
Dehumidification/ vapor control: to keep wetness levels steady.
If your cellar smells moldy, reveals efflorescence (white mineral deposits), or you observe damp walls after rainfall, a waterproofing evaluation is a wise following step-- particularly prior to finishing a basement.
Sump Pump Replacement Kansas City: Why It Issues Greater Than You Think.
A sump pump is a gadget mounted in a pit (sump basin) that triggers when water rises to an established degree, then pumps it out with a discharge line to aid prevent flooding. There are two typical kinds: pedestal and submersible pumps, and lots of homes additionally use backup systems for interruption defense.
When to consider Sump Pump Replacement Kansas City.
The pump runs continuously or short-cycles.
Odd sounds or vibration.
The pump fails to switch on throughout an examination.
Constant water alarms or near-overflows during storms.
The pump is aging and you desire integrity prior to peak rain seasons.
Because Kansas City can see intense rain occasions, home owners often treat Sump Pump Replacement Kansas City as preventive danger administration-- particularly if the cellar is ended up or made use of for storage space.
Pro pointer: Inquire about discharge routing (away from the foundation) and whether a battery backup is appropriate for your situation.
Crawl Space Encapsulation Kansas City: Cleaner Air, Lower Moisture, Better Efficiency.
If your home has a crawl space, moisture can enter from the soil and migrate upward into the living area. Proper moisture control frequently includes installing a ground vapor barrier and sealing seams/wall transitions to reduce moisture diffusion. The United State Division of Power generally advises utilizing a polyethylene vapor diffusion obstacle over crawl space floors (with overlapped seams, taped joints, and sealing up the walls) as part of moisture control strategies.
What Crawl Space Encapsulation Kansas City typically consists of.
Sturdy vapor obstacle on the ground and up structure walls.
Sealing vents and air leaks (in "shut" crawl space layouts).
Insulation method (typically along crawl space walls rather than the floor above, relying on layout).
Optional dehumidifier for long-lasting humidity control.
Drainage/sump solutions if groundwater breach exists.
The benefit isn't just convenience. An effectively handled crawl space can decrease mold threat and enhance indoor air quality-- vital for youngsters, allergy sufferers, and any person conscious damp environments.

Practical Avoidance Tips (Even Before Fixings).
These basics minimize water load and soil activity-- often reducing the likelihood of future problems:.
Tidy gutters and prolong downspouts faraway from the structure.
Maintain favorable grading (dirt slopes away from the home).
Maintain landscape design beds from trapping water versus structure walls.
Examination sump pumps seasonally and keep the container clear.
Control interior moisture (especially in basements and crawl spaces).
These steps won't replace architectural repair work if you need it, however they can meaningfully enhance efficiency after repairs-- and occasionally stop troubles from becoming worse.
